Job Summary
Plan, implement, coordinate and supervise programs and activities for youth/teens at the Club. Facilitate programming in arts and gym, manage calendars, lesson plans, pre/post testing, roster keeping, and participation tracking. Transport youth to club locations using BGCMP vehicles. Ensure member safety and complete proper documentation. Assist with the Federal Food program as directed. Must possess a high school diploma or equivalency and obtain/maintain CPR, First Aid, and Food Handler’s Certification within 90 days. Must have and maintain a valid Arizona driver’s license. Knowledge of federal/state laws and Club policies; ability to manage groups; strong communication and relationship-building skills; capacity to support volunteers and future workforce needs.
